More recent 3D CAD packages allow for helical extrusions.  I've had pretty good results using just 60 data points for a blade, 90 should be plenty for something to be pretty.  You then take that profile and sweep it along a helical path.  To get the new profile, I imagine you would create a plane perpendicular to the helical path and slice the solid.

ok i have the following problem...

the description of the assignment is in the pdf

and the 3D model is in the wrl file

just discuss how you could do this ? Don't feel obliged

 

i have no problems to create an naca2420 airfoil in cad, just import the coordiantes files, but i don't get it how i can make it helicoidal ?
